日期:2014-05-16  浏览次数:20461 次

oracle多行结果列转化为字符串函数wmsys.wm_concat()
wm_concat()是oracle的内置方法,在10g以及以后的版本是好使的,9i是不好使的;

如我们查询到的结果是:
班级    学生姓名
1 a
1             b
1             c
1             d


sql:  select 班级,wmsys.wm_concat(学生姓名)  from 表 group by 班级;
查询到的结果是:
班级       学生姓名
  1           a,b,c,d